Peptide stability is challenged by oxidation of susceptible residues such as methionine and cysteine. For instance, ester bonds are prone to hydrolysis by esterases, whereas amide bonds generally show greater resistance. Overall, peptide stability can be enhanced through structural modifications such as cyclization or amino acid substitution.

MMP activity is regulated by endogenous tissue inhibitors that bind to the active enzyme sites. Mechanical stress and ultraviolet radiation are known to modulate MMP expression. MMP-9 activity is elevated in diabetic dermis due to hyperglycemia-induced oxidative stress and AGE-RAGE signaling. For instance, TIMP-1 and TIMP-2 are widely distributed and inhibit multiple MMP family members.
